Albert Ramirez beats Lerrone Richards by SD on 5 June 2026
Albert Ramirez edged Lerrone Richards by split decision in their heavyweight/" class="internal-link text-bone underline decoration-ash/30 hover:decoration-gold underline-offset-2">light-heavyweight clash on 5 June, preserving his unbeaten record in a closely contested affair. The victory moved Ramirez to 23-0 whilst Richards slipped to 20-2, suffering his second career defeat in a bout that went the full distance.
How it ended
All three judges were called upon to separate the pair after a hard-fought battle that saw neither man gain a decisive edge. The split verdict underscored how fine the margins were, with Ramirez doing enough in the eyes of two scorecards to claim the win. Richards pushed throughout but fell narrowly short on the night.
